Abstract

To provide a fastener which enables reduction of insertion resistance to an attachment hole.SOLUTION: A fastener 100 is attached to an attachment hole 111 of an attached member 110 and includes: a cylindrical inner wall part 101; an outer wall part 102 arranged coaxially with the inner wall part and spaced apart to the outer side therefrom; a connection part 103 which connects a base end part of the inner wall part with a base end part of the outer wall part and is disposed at the front side of the attachment hole; an elastic engagement piece 104 which extends from a tip side outer periphery, located at the rear side of the attachment hole, of the outer wall part and engages with a rear surface of the attached member; a flange part 105 which extends from a base end part outer periphery of the outer wall part and engages with a surface of the attached member; and a closing part 106 which closes the inner side of the inner wall part.SELECTED DRAWING: Figure 3

本発明は、例えば、被取付部材に設けられた孔を閉塞するために用いられるホールプラグなどに好適な留め具に関する。 The present invention relates to a fastener suitable for, for example, a hole plug used for closing a hole provided in a member to be attached.

例えば、自動車の車体パネルやリッドには、種々の目的に応じて、孔が形成されることがある。このような孔をそのままにしておくと、シール性や見栄え等の点で問題が生じることがあるので、一般的にはホールプラグなどの留め具で閉塞するようにしている。 For example, holes may be formed in the body panels and lids of automobiles for various purposes. If such holes are left as they are, problems may occur in terms of sealing performance, appearance, etc. Therefore, in general, the holes are closed with fasteners such as hole plugs.

このようなホールプラグなどに好適な留め具として、下記特許文献1には、下端が閉塞され、上端が開口した筒状体の上端外周から、取付孔の表側周縁に係合する第2シーリングリップ(28)が延出され、上記筒状体の下端外周から取付孔の内周に当接するばね要素(34)が延出され、ばね要素(34)の下端側外周から取付孔の裏側周縁に係合する第1シーリングリップ(26)が延出されたシーリングプラグが開示されている(Fig.7参照)。 As a fastener suitable for such a hole plug or the like, the following Patent Document 1 describes a second sealing lip that engages with the front peripheral edge of a mounting hole from the outer peripheral edge of the upper end of a tubular body whose lower end is closed and whose upper end is open. (28) is extended, and a spring element (34) that abuts on the inner circumference of the mounting hole is extended from the outer circumference of the lower end of the tubular body, and extends from the lower end side outer circumference of the spring element (34) to the back peripheral edge of the mounting hole. A sealing plug with an extended first sealing lip (26) to engage is disclosed (see Fig. 7).

国際公開WO2010/121749International release WO 2010/121749

上記特許文献1のシーリングプラグでは、ばね要素(34)の筒状体の下端部への連結部と、第1シーリングリップ(26)のばね要素(34)への連結部との距離が短いため、取付孔に挿入する際にばね要素(34)が内側に撓みにくくなり、挿入抵抗が高くなるという問題があった。 In the sealing plug of Patent Document 1, the distance between the connecting portion of the spring element (34) to the lower end of the tubular body and the connecting portion of the first sealing lip (26) to the spring element (34) is short. There is a problem that the spring element (34) is less likely to bend inward when it is inserted into the mounting hole, and the insertion resistance is increased.

したがって、本発明の目的は、取付孔への挿入抵抗を低減できる留め具を提供することにある。 Therefore, an object of the present invention is to provide a fastener capable of reducing insertion resistance into a mounting hole.

上記目的を達成するため、本発明の留め具は、被取付部材の取付孔に取付けられる留め具であって、筒状をなす内壁部と、前記内壁部に対して外側に離間して同心状に配置された外壁部と、前記内壁部の基端部と前記外壁部の基端部とを連結し、前記取付孔の表側に配置される連結部と、前記外壁部の、前記取付孔の裏側に位置する先端側外周から延出して前記被取付部材の裏面に係合する弾性係合片と、前記外壁部の基端部外周から延出して前記被取付部材の表面に係合するフランジ部と、前記内壁部の内側を閉塞する閉塞部とを備えていることを特徴とする。 In order to achieve the above object, the fastener of the present invention is a fastener attached to a mounting hole of a member to be attached, and has a tubular inner wall portion and a concentric shape separated outward from the inner wall portion. The outer wall portion arranged in, the base end portion of the inner wall portion, and the base end portion of the outer wall portion are connected, and the connecting portion arranged on the front side of the mounting hole and the mounting hole of the outer wall portion. An elastic engaging piece that extends from the outer periphery of the tip side located on the back side and engages with the back surface of the attached member, and a flange that extends from the outer periphery of the base end portion of the outer wall portion and engages with the surface of the attached member. It is characterized by including a portion and a closing portion that closes the inside of the inner wall portion.

本発明によれば、連結部が取付孔の表側に配置され、弾性係合片の、外壁部からの延出位置が取付孔の裏側に配置されるので、連結部と延出位置との距離を長くとることができる。このため、留め具を取付けるために外壁部及び内壁部を被取付部材の取付孔に挿入する際に、外壁部が内側に撓みやすくなり、挿入抵抗を小さくすることができる。 According to the present invention, the connecting portion is arranged on the front side of the mounting hole, and the extension position of the elastic engaging piece from the outer wall portion is arranged on the back side of the mounting hole, so that the distance between the connecting portion and the extending position Can be taken for a long time. Therefore, when the outer wall portion and the inner wall portion are inserted into the mounting holes of the member to be attached in order to attach the fastener, the outer wall portion tends to bend inward, and the insertion resistance can be reduced.

次に、この留め具100の作用について説明する。図1に示すように、この留め具100は、被取付部材110の取付孔111を閉塞するために、取付孔111に挿入固定されるものである。 Next, the operation of the fastener 100 will be described. As shown in FIG. 1, the fastener 100 is inserted and fixed in the mounting hole 111 in order to close the mounting hole 111 of the member to be mounted 110.

図5には、留め具100の内壁部101及び外壁部102を被取付部材110の取付孔111に挿入する際の弾性係合片104及び外壁部102の変形過程が示されている。 FIG. 5 shows the deformation process of the elastic engaging piece 104 and the outer wall portion 102 when the inner wall portion 101 and the outer wall portion 102 of the fastener 100 are inserted into the mounting holes 111 of the mounted member 110.

同図(a)、(b)に示すように、被取付部材110の取付孔111に留め具100の内壁部101及び外壁部102を挿入すると、外壁部102から延出された弾性係合片104が取付孔111の内周に当接し、弾性係合片104を介して外壁部102が内方に押圧されて変形し、外壁部102の中間部102bが内壁部101に接する。なお、外壁部102の中間部102bは、内壁部101の外周に最接近すればよく、必ずしも当接しなくてもよい。 As shown in FIGS. (A) and (b), when the inner wall portion 101 and the outer wall portion 102 of the fastener 100 are inserted into the mounting holes 111 of the mounted member 110, the elastic engaging piece extending from the outer wall portion 102. The 104 comes into contact with the inner circumference of the mounting hole 111, the outer wall portion 102 is pressed inward via the elastic engaging piece 104 and deformed, and the intermediate portion 102b of the outer wall portion 102 comes into contact with the inner wall portion 101. The intermediate portion 102b of the outer wall portion 102 may be closest to the outer circumference of the inner wall portion 101 and does not necessarily come into contact with the outer wall portion 101.

外壁部102を更に押し込むと、同図(c)に示すように、弾性係合片104が取付孔111の内周に押圧されて変形し、変形した外壁部102の中間部102bによって形成された凹部に、変形した弾性係合片104が入り込み、比較的低い挿入抵抗で取付孔111を通過することができる。 When the outer wall portion 102 is further pushed in, as shown in FIG. 3C, the elastic engaging piece 104 is pressed against the inner circumference of the mounting hole 111 and deformed, and is formed by the intermediate portion 102b of the deformed outer wall portion 102. The deformed elastic engagement piece 104 can enter the recess and pass through the mounting hole 111 with a relatively low insertion resistance.

こうして、弾性係合片104の先端部104aが取付孔111を通過すると、弾性復元力によって弾性係合片104が被取付部材110の裏面の取付孔111の周縁に係合する。また、フランジ部105の先端部105aは、被取付部材110の表面の取付孔111の周縁に押圧されて係合する。その結果、被取付部材110がフランジ部105と弾性係合片104とによって挟持され、留め具100を被取付部材110の取付孔111に挿入固定することができる。このとき、被取付部材110の表面の取付孔111周縁はフランジ部105によってシールされ、被取付部材110の裏面の取付孔111の周縁は弾性係合片104によってシールされるので、取付孔111を気密性よくシールすることができる。 In this way, when the tip portion 104a of the elastic engaging piece 104 passes through the mounting hole 111, the elastic engaging piece 104 engages with the peripheral edge of the mounting hole 111 on the back surface of the mounted member 110 by the elastic restoring force. Further, the tip portion 105a of the flange portion 105 is pressed against and engaged with the peripheral edge of the mounting hole 111 on the surface of the mounted member 110. As a result, the mounted member 110 is sandwiched between the flange portion 105 and the elastic engaging piece 104, and the fastener 100 can be inserted and fixed in the mounting hole 111 of the mounted member 110. At this time, the peripheral edge of the mounting hole 111 on the front surface of the mounted member 110 is sealed by the flange portion 105, and the peripheral edge of the mounting hole 111 on the back surface of the mounted member 110 is sealed by the elastic engaging piece 104. Can be sealed with good airtightness.

また、変形した外壁部102の中間部102bによって形成された凹部に、変形した弾性係合片104が入り込んで取付孔111を通過するので、外壁部102の外径を取付孔111の内径に近づけることができ、外壁部102が弾性復帰したときの外壁部102外周と取付孔111内周との隙間を小さくして、取付孔111に装着した状態での留め具100の径方向のガタ付きを抑制することができる。 Further, since the deformed elastic engaging piece 104 enters the recess formed by the intermediate portion 102b of the deformed outer wall portion 102 and passes through the mounting hole 111, the outer diameter of the outer wall portion 102 is brought closer to the inner diameter of the mounting hole 111. It is possible to reduce the gap between the outer circumference of the outer wall portion 102 and the inner circumference of the mounting hole 111 when the outer wall portion 102 is elastically restored, so that the fastener 100 is loosened in the radial direction when mounted in the mounting hole 111. It can be suppressed.

図6には、こうして被取付部材110の取付孔111に装着された留め具100に引き抜き力Fが作用したときの弾性係合片104及び外壁部102の変形過程が示されている。 FIG. 6 shows the deformation process of the elastic engaging piece 104 and the outer wall portion 102 when the pulling force F acts on the fastener 100 thus mounted in the mounting hole 111 of the mounted member 110.

同図(a)に示す状態で引き抜き力Fが作用すると、同図(b)に示すように、弾性係合片104が下方に押されて変形し、それに伴って外壁部102の先端部102aが内側に変形して内壁部101の外周に当接する。更に、引き抜き力Fが作用すると、同図(c)に示すように、外壁部102の先端部102aが内壁部101の外周に強く押圧されるが、内壁部101によってそれ以上の変形を抑制されるので、弾性係合片104はそれ以上大きく変形することが抑制され、しかも、最も肉厚とされた基部104bが取付孔111の内周に係合するので、強い引き抜き抵抗力が得られる。 When the pulling force F acts in the state shown in FIG. (A), the elastic engaging piece 104 is pushed downward and deformed as shown in FIG. (B), and accordingly, the tip portion 102a of the outer wall portion 102a Deforms inward and comes into contact with the outer circumference of the inner wall portion 101. Further, when the pulling force F acts, as shown in FIG. 3C, the tip portion 102a of the outer wall portion 102 is strongly pressed against the outer periphery of the inner wall portion 101, but further deformation is suppressed by the inner wall portion 101. Therefore, the elastic engagement piece 104 is suppressed from being further deformed, and the thickest base portion 104b engages with the inner circumference of the mounting hole 111, so that a strong pull-out resistance force can be obtained.

なお、外壁部102は、弾性係合片104が被取付部材110の裏面の取付孔111の周縁に係合した状態で、強い引き抜き力Fが作用すると、下方に引き延ばされる力が作用するが、内壁部101の先端部101aは、外壁部102の先端部102aより下方に長く突出しているので、先端部102aが先端部101aを乗り越えて内側に入り込むことを阻止できる。その結果、弾性係合片104が反り返って係合が解除され、留め具100が引き抜かれてしまう虞れを少なくすることができる。 When a strong pulling force F is applied to the outer wall portion 102 in a state where the elastic engaging piece 104 is engaged with the peripheral edge of the mounting hole 111 on the back surface of the mounted member 110, a force that stretches downward acts. Since the tip portion 101a of the inner wall portion 101 projects long downward from the tip portion 102a of the outer wall portion 102, it is possible to prevent the tip portion 102a from getting over the tip portion 101a and entering the inside. As a result, the elastic engaging piece 104 can be warped and disengaged, and the possibility that the fastener 100 is pulled out can be reduced.
